This is the mystery European MF mount made from aluminum. It measures 130mm
x 70mm with 55x50 horizontal windows. The centers are 65mm apart. Although
a little flimsy, the great thing about these is that the chips just slide
in the back (as shown) with no adhesives required at all. Does ANYONE out
there know where to get these?
